Content that is not accessible

The following content is not barrier-free as it does not comply with the underlying harmonized standard EN 301 549:

  • There are images without captions on several pages. It is difficult to navigate to the images with screen readers.
  • There are links without link text on several pages.
  • The contrast between text and background is too low on all pages.
  • On several pages there are 'iframe' elements without captions. Navigation with screen readers to the iframes is difficult.
  • One page has no language stored in HTML.
  • On some pages, the language stored in HTML does not match the page language.
  • There are form fields without labels on individual pages. Navigation with screen readers to the form fields is difficult.
  • On some pages there are headings that do not have a label or contain the aria-hidden attribute and are therefore not accessible for screen readers.
  • The meta viewport prevents zooming on almost all pages. Deactivating the zoom makes page content more difficult to read for people with visual impairments.
  • There are tables on a page that are not laid out correctly. Not all table data is assigned to table headers. It is not always clear which table content belongs to which table header.
  • On many pages, a superordinate element lacks the appropriate subordinate elements. This can confuse screen reader users, as content is expected but none is present.
  • On some pages, there are elements with the Aria-hidden attribute that can be focused at the same time. As a result, these elements are accessible for assistive technologies, although they should be hidden.
  • There are ARIA buttons, links or menu items on a page without labeling. It is difficult to navigate to these elements with screen readers.
